RE: [released] Official XBMC Remote for iOS - joethefox - 2012-09-04

Version 1.1.6 has been released with this change log:
- Support for latest Frodo builds. Warning: this update breaks compatibility with XBMC Frodo v12 prior 6 August.
- added "View Details" for Music Albums (long press item action)
- added "View Details" for Music Artists (long press item action)


RE: [released] Official XBMC Remote for iOS - kmfdm515 - 2012-09-04

Really great app. 2 quick questions:

1) is there a way to choose the default view that comes up for Music, instead of the 'Album' view? Having the 'Artist' view as default seems to make much more sense to me. I did a search and found a couple posts asking the same thing, but never saw an answer.

2) is there any way to have the Artist Genre use the Genre from the ID3 tags instead of the Genre from The Artist Info? All my music is tagged with correct Genres, but the Genres fro Artist Info that are pulled by the Scraper are all messed up.

Thanks...


RE: [released] Official XBMC Remote for iOS - joethefox - 2012-09-04

thank you!

1) No, but it's in my TODO list
2) This seems hard to accomplish because what the app displays is what that XBMC sends, that is the scraped genre.
